Report of independent review of Part 1D of the Crimes Act 1914 - Forensic procedures - March 2003

Under section 23YV of the Crimes Act 1914, an independent review of Part 1D is being conducted.  Part 1D provides for forensic procedures to be carried out on suspects for federal indictable offences, federal offenders for prescribed and serious offences and on volunteers.
